Take Our Kids to Work Day

Mark your calendars for November 5, 2025, the official Take Our Kids to Work Day! Take Our Kids to Work Day is an annual career exploration event, held every November, where Grade 9 students spend the day in the life of a working professional.  Students spend the day at the workplace of a parent, relative, friend, or volunteer host, witnessing first-hand the world of work, prompting early career planning, and enabling students to make informed decisions about their future goals and endeavours. The event also gives parents the opportunity to discuss career prospects with their children, and allows businesses to share knowledge, experience and advice around education, career choices and relevant skills required in today’s workplace.  As part of your child’s Career 9 class, we are hoping that your child will be able to participate on November 5th.
The more students understand about the jobs of their parents and relatives, the more informed the decisions about their own future career.  For more information, please visit takeourkidstowork.ca.
Staff are aware of this day, and know all grade 9s will be out in the community participating in this, so there will not be missed classes or tests. Students that do not participate, will have regular classes for the day.
